CVE-2025-11619
HIGHCVSS 8.8/10EPSS 0.22%
Last modified
CVE-2025-11619 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 8.8/10 on the CVSS scale. Improper certificate validation when connecting to gateways in Devolutions Server 2025.3.2 and earlier allows attackers in MitM position to intercept traffic.. EPSS estimates a 0.22%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
Description
Improper certificate validation when connecting to gateways in Devolutions Server 2025.3.2 and earlier allows attackers in MitM position to intercept traffic.
Metrics
C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H

Affected Software
| Vendor | Product | Versions |
|---|---|---|
| Devolutions | Devolutions Server | < 2025.2.15.0 |
| Devolutions | Devolutions Server | >= 2025.3.2.0, < 2025.3.3.0 |
